Before commencing the chemical peeling therapy, it is important to cleanse the affected person's pores and skin employing a degreasing agent, such as isopropyl alcohol or acetone, to remove residual makeup or debris.[5] The individual need to be positioned supine, with the head in the mattress elevated to forty five degrees for that technique.[11] A hair cap ought to be worn to keep the hair from the treatment spot. The clinician may perhaps choose to utilize petroleum jelly to places at risk of opportunity chemical pooling, including the nasolabial folds and lateral canthi.

All chemical peels take out a controlled degree of skin cells with the epidermis. A more powerful peel could also eliminate a little Component of the dermis.

Agony relief just isn't typically necessary for a lightweight chemical peel. If you are using a medium peel, you may get a sedative and painkiller. For just a deep peel, you might have a sedative, anything to numb the procedure region and fluids sent by way of a vein.

All through a deep chemical peel, you may be sedated. The medical doctor will use a cotton-tipped applicator to use phenol to the skin. This will transform the skin white or grey. The method will probably be finished in fifteen-minute portions, to Restrict the pores and skin publicity to your acid.

Frequently, superficial peels can be utilized on all pores and skin types. Nonetheless, When you've got a darker skin tone, you have a increased threat of encountering a darkening of your skin soon after cure.

Salicylic acid: This beta hydroxy acid (BHA) features a hydroxyl group linked to the next carbon. Salicylic acid offers better lipophilicity than glycolic acid, allowing it to penetrate the skin additional effectively.

The skin layers sooner or later peel off revealing additional youthful skin. The new pores and skin will likely be smoother with fewer lines and wrinkles, has a more even shade and is also brighter in complexion.

A chemical peel is actually a technique in which a chemical Answer is placed on the pores and skin to remove the very best levels. The pores and skin that grows back is smoother. With a light or medium peel, you may have to undertake the procedure over the moment for getting the desired final results.
